    The Board of Claims is composed of five members who are appointed by the governor for four-year terms in accordance with KRS 44.070(2)(3). A member of the board is chosen by the governor to serve as chairman for a term of four years. The board meets once each month, usually on the third Thursday of the month.

    Hearing officers are appointed by the governor. Each hearing officer must be an attorney licensed to practice law in Kentucky and shall have practiced law for at least three years, in accordance with KRS 44.070 (6). Upon direction of the chairman or the board, these hearing officers conduct hearings and otherwise supervise the presentation of evidence. They shall not render final decisions, orders or awards, but shall make recommendations to the board.
